Hi all
While cleaning up the wsgi code I bumped into a few problems with the
current logging functionality.
Using the tools.make_logger("/path/to/logfile") it is not possible to
log to different logfiles.
Every new call to tools.make_logger hijackes all log messages from
previous callers.
For example the comments plugin logs to a file called
/<logdir>/comments.log. The xmlrpc_metaweblog plugin to a file named
/<logdir>/metaweblog.log. All messages logged by comments are logged to
metaweblog.log. Depending on who called tools.make_logger last.
Here's a patch that changes this behaviour. It wasn't possible to
correct this with the old API. So I changed it, back-combat offcourse.
Old:
tools.make_logger("/path/to/logfile")
tools.log("whatever")
New:
log = tools.getLogger(filename="/path/to/logfile")
log.info("some info")
log.error("some error")
log.setLevel(log.DEBUG)
log.debug("some debug message")
# or:
log = tools.getLogger("logname", "debug")
# this logs to /<logdir>/logname.log setting the default loglevel to DEBUG.
# or: backwards compatible
# note: this still hijackes log messages.
tools.make_logger("/path/to/logfile")
tools.log("whatever")
I added a initialize and a cleanup function to the tools.py module.
They are called from PyBlosxom.initialize resp. PyBlosxom.cleanup.
These calls are used to set initial logdir resp. to close open logfiles
when done.
The patch changes the following files:
/pyblosxom/Pyblosxom/tools.py
/pyblosxom/Pyblosxom/pyblosxom.py
Do you see any problems with this?
